eBay’s mission is to provide the best online shopping experience, helping buyers quickly find what they’re looking for. This means keywords play a crucial role when selling on eBay.
Start by doing keyword research. Enter terms relevant to your product selection and check the results. Find the top-rated sellers on the first page and take note of the essential keywords they use. Then, incorporate the phrases in these areas of your own store:
At the same time, leverage tools such as Google Trends, Ahrefs, or Semrush to find trending keywords and search terms.
A good rule of thumb for eBay SEO is to use the most searched-for keywords first, naturally embedding them into your listings without overusing them.
As per eBay’s guidelines on optimizing listings, product descriptions should be around 200 words, with important keyword phrases making up 5-7%. So in 200 words of text, use your keywords 10-14 times.
The best listings are short, clear, and precise. Do competitive research and explore their listings for inspiration, noting ones that rank on the first page.

While categories are not the first means of navigation, they’re a crucial secondary filter to make the search result more relevant.
Select the most appropriate category so that eBay buyers can still find your listing. Failing to do so risks your product visibility on Cassini, as eBay considers category accuracy when ranking listings.
As more buyers turn to digital shopping, it’s crucial to optimize your eBay listings for mobile devices. In fact, more than half of all eBay transactions were viewed on a mobile device prior to purchase, making this eBay SEO strategy vital.
Check whether your listing is mobile-friendly by following eBay’s best practices for creating listings. Strategies include using fast-loading images, writing short and clear descriptions, and avoiding excessive HTML or custom fonts that don’t display well on mobile.
In a marketplace as vast as eBay, potential buyers rely heavily on filters.
If you want your products to be visible, you need to provide item specifics like brand, size, type, and color. In doing so, your eBay listing will gain better visibility in search results to help drive more sales.

eBay is well-known for great bargains, so offer competitive prices but leave some room for negotiation.
Pricing is essential in eBay’s product-based shopping model, where similar items are grouped together. If you offer a competitive price, eBay’s algorithm will more likely rank your listing higher in Best Match searches.

Cassini favors active stores as it signals engagement and relevance to buyers, so regularly add new products and update old listings for better visibility.
To keep your eBay store catalog up to date, use eBay’s scheduling feature to publish new items. This helps maintain a steady flow of fresh inventory, encourages more frequent visits, and improves your store’s performance in eBay’s search algorithm.
Free shipping and returns make it easier to entice people to purchase and sway undecided buyers.
Evaluate your costs and see whether offering free shipping is viable. One solution is to incorporate delivery costs into the item’s price. Alternatively, offer free shipping to customers who reach a minimum order amount.
Creating a fair return policy is also important, since many buyers are hesitant when making online purchases with new sellers. The policy helps establish your eBay store’s trustworthiness, giving potential buyers peace of mind and ultimately improving your conversion rate.
Offering guaranteed delivery, combined with free shipping and a fair return policy, creates a winning combination that drives purchases.
With it, you promise customers that their items will arrive by a specific date. If not, eBay will make it right by providing options like refunded shipping or a shopping voucher. This assurance builds buyer confidence and helps convert views into sales.

To stand out among other eBay stores, become one of the platform’s very best sellers by meeting eBay’s Top-Rated Seller benchmarks. These include a low defect rate, low late shipment rate, and a few cases closed without seller resolution.
Although earning this status requires time, patience, persistence, and exceptional service on your part as a seller, it’s a worthwhile endeavor that will result in better visibility and more eBay sales.
